In 1981, my parents embarked on a courageous journey to spread the Gospel as missionaries from Italy to France. Growing up, we resided in a Christian community, which also happened to be a Bible school. It played a vital role in shaping my formative years. Although this period significantly impacted my upbringing, I had never contemplated following my parents’ path to become a missionary. However, in 2005, everything changed when I was invited to attend a Jesus revolution concert that left an indelible mark on my soul. I felt God’s presence so strongly in the room, and I realized that was the kind of Christianity I longed for.

During this event, I felt a prompting from the Holy Spirit to join the Jesus revolution summer team. Although the dates did not match, I couldn’t shake off the feeling that the Holy Spirit was trying to show me something. A few weeks later, I had a dream about a man sitting on a rock by the shore. As I approached the man, the Holy Spirit spoke to me and showed me that he was the director of Jesus revolution, and I would serve the Lord next to him. He showed me details I could not know on my own.
I woke up confused and didn’t understand the dream. A short time later, while at a prayer meeting, a pastor had a vision. It was as if a screen rolled down from the ceiling before his eyes. He described the «movie». He saw my wife and me in a boat, in the North Sea, and there was a raging storm. He also saw a lighthouse in Norway and heard the Holy Spirit saying that Norway was where we would find our destiny. After describing the whole «movie», it all rolled up the same way it had rolled down.
We were left with a mixture of confusion and anticipation having been exposed to such profound experiences. The Challenge of Letting Go
We were unsure whether God had truly called us to Norway. We had concerns about leaving our families, our home, and our jobs. We also wondered how we would manage without a job and how we would learn the language. We decided to spend a week seeking God in a cabin, and the Holy Spirit answered our questions, this time with a question of His own: «Are you the one who is to come, or shall we wait for someone else?» (Matthew 11:3). Just as John the Baptist had doubts, we had our doubts as well. We wondered if Norway was truly the answer to our call or if we were supposed to wait for something else.
The Holy Spirit’s question felt like a bomb inside us. It became clear to us that Norway was, in fact, God’s response to our calling and that we should not delay any longer. Additionally, the Holy Spirit directed us to sell all of our possessions and donate the proceeds to those in need. We followed His guidance and set out on a faith journey that brought us to Norway just a few months later.

Enrolling in the Bible school Evidence of Faith (tbbmi.no) in Oslo, we fully committed ourselves to our faith journey. During our time there, we learned to rely on God’s provisions rather than our own savings, and through every season, He proved to be faithful.
